Latest Patents

Watanabe's latest patents include a magnetic alloy characterized by the compositional formula Fe-O-N. This innovative alloy is designed for use in magnetic heads, showcasing a specific compositional formula of Fe.sub.v N.sub.w O.sub.x M.sub.y. In this formula, M represents elements such as Ta, Nb, Si, and mixtures thereof. The values of v, w, x, and y are defined by atomic percent, ensuring that 1 ≤ w ≤ 20, 1 ≤ x ≤ 20, and 0.5 ≤ y ≤ 6, with the constraint that v + w + x + y = 100. Additionally, these alloys may include elements from the platinum group or group VIa of the periodic table to enhance their corrosion resistance.
